This document is an email chain from March 2021 concerning discovery and evidence review in the US v. Maxwell case. The correspondence primarily involves Laura Menninger (defense counsel) and an Assistant United States Attorney, discussing the availability and indexing of highly confidential physical evidence and images held by the FBI. Delays in providing answers and access to evidence are noted, with discussions around FBI team availability and the completeness of existing evidence inventories.

This document is a chain of emails between the U.S. Attorney's Office (SDNY) and defense counsel for Ghislaine Maxwell (Laura Menninger) from March 2021. The correspondence concerns the scheduling of a review of 'highly confidential images' and physical evidence at 500 Pearl Street, as well as the production of indices listing items seized by the FBI from Jeffrey Epstein's residences in New York and the Virgin Islands in 2019. The prosecutor clarifies which items are indexed in spreadsheets versus search warrant returns and coordinates a phone call to discuss these matters.
